- 1965 UK Great Britain British Crown Churchill Queen Elizabeth II Coin1965 UK Great Britain British Crown Churchill Queen Elizabeth II Coin Minted to commemorate the passing of Sir Winston Churchill in 1965. When minted, they were worth five shillings under the old monetary system. When the UK decimalized its currency from the old 1 pound = 20 shillings = 240 pence system to a straight 1 pound = 100 pence, five-shilling coins became worth 25p.
